7.0 Determining the Effectiveness of Audiovisual 
Cancer Education Materials for African Americans

Even with information obtained directly from members of the African-American community, some parts of the audiovisual cancer education material still will not be understood by or culturally sensitive to all African-American audiences. Pretesting the audiovisual cancer education material provides information on how well the audience comprehends and accepts the material. Focus group meetings and key informant interviews are methods to help determine how well the cancer prevention message reaches the African-American audience.
